Originally Posted by Clang
The brakes have room to adjust to a smaller wheel, right? If you're replacing wheelsets and you don't like 27" rims, why not just swap to 700c?
And going from 27" to 700c will give you a wee bit more clearance for wider tires (should you want them...).
